Problem Statement

We are given five equal-looking weights of pairwise distinct masses. For any three weights AA, BB, CC, we can check by a measuring if m(A)<m(B)<m(C)m(A) < m(B) < m(C), where m(X)m(X) denotes the mass of a weight XX (the answer is yes or no.) Can we always arrange the masses of the weights in the increasing order with at most nine measurings?
